Brunsting, Nelson C.; Sreckovic, Melissa A.; Lane, Kathleen Lynne – Education and Treatment of Children, 2014
Teacher burnout occurs when teachers undergoing stress for long periods of time experience emotional exhaustion, depersonalization, and lack of personal accomplishment (Maslach, 2003). Outcomes associated with burnout include teacher attrition, teacher health issues, and negative student outcomes. Special educators are at high risk for burnout as…
